你是否還在苦苦尋找一些精美小圖案嗎?其實Excel中自帶大量的小圖案,總有一個是你想要的哦!
圖案的由來
1、在說小圖案之前,先了解下char()函數,char()函數可以将一個數字轉換成一個字符(數字指定的字符),如char(1)返回“”、char(33)返回‘!’等等,其中數字必須介于1到255之間。
2、Excel中存在多種符号字體系列,它們可以将各種字符渲染成各種各樣的小圖案。
如下圖所示,一個普通狀态下的英文感歎号,通過改變字體樣式,變成不同的圖案。
通過以上兩點,我們發現,可以先用char()函數作用在一個數字上,再更換字體,以此來達到形成不同的圖案。
下圖為四種字體分别作用在不同字符上顯示出來的小圖案。A列為數字33-128,B/C/D/E列為不同的字體樣式;
輸入公式:=char(a2),将數字轉換成字符,再更改字體,即可達到如下圖的效果:
至于為什麼選取33-128之間的數字,因為這四種字體的圖案基本分布在這個數字區間内,其它數字返回的圖案無實用性,小夥伴們可自行嘗試。
圖案展示1、Webdings字體
2、Wingdings字體
3、Wingdings 2字體
4、Wingdings 3字體
這裡僅展示4種字體的小圖案,其它字體小夥伴們可自行嘗試。
圖案的妙用這麼多的小圖案,自然有它的作用,比如:
1、單元格輸入對與錯
将單元格字體格式調整為Wingdings 2,輸入=char(79)返回"×",=char(80)返回"√";
2、各種導向符号
3、圖案填充
下圖中使用Wingdings字體,作用在char(74)上返回笑臉,char(75)返回沉默臉,char(76)返回哭表情臉,在通過REPT函數,繪制出不同長度的圖形。
下圖中使用Webdings字體,作用在char(128)上返回小人,在通過REPT函數,繪制出不同長度的圖形。
小結
通過更改字體樣式來返回不同的小圖案,你學會了嗎?如果你遲遲找不到合适的小圖案來填充你的圖形,不妨試試這個小技巧,如果覺得有用,歡迎關注我,定期分享數據小技巧!
,